Show Local Water Systems Rated Following are the names of local communities whose water supplies fall into the different rlAislflcatlous of "Approved", "Provisionally Approved", and "Not Approved", baaed on vval-nations made by the Utah State Dept. of Health for the calendar year 1964. "Approved" means that the supply Is adequately protected against the entrance of contamination or Is being subjected to satisfactory treatment. "Approved Provisionally" means that the supply Is adequately protected against the entrance of contamination except for minor items which are in process ot correction; or, in the case of a treated supply, that additional treatment facilities required are now being planned. "Not approved" means that the supply Is not adequately protected against entrance of contamination, or that necessary treatment facilities are not pro-Wded, or that existing treatment facilities are inadequate or not render the water supply safe at all times. Approved: Clrclevllle, Hatch. Approved Provisionally: pa gultch. Not Approved: Antimony, Es-calante, Cannonvtlle, Henrle-ville. Tropic. |
